Stopped at the Regency Park hotel for a family wedding. We booked 2 rooms that were perfect for our use, clean well appointed and comfy for our short stay, we arrived early for our check in, the room was not ready but they let us get changed in the health club so we can get to the wedding which was extremely helpful. We had breakfast the next day, which was very nice and l would happily use them again.

As a regular traveller I can honestly say that The regency park hotel is possibly one of the worst hotels I have ever stayed in. It was like stepping back in time. The entire experience was almost comical. Starting with the reception that seemed to never have staff on it because they are too busy out the back sleeping or away for a wander. The only lift to our room was broken which the receptionist failed to tell us when we checked in and so we had to lug 3 heavy suitcases up the narrowest, sweatiest and smelliest back staircase to our room. The bar was closed at 10pm when we arrived we weren’t able to get a drink and then the restaurant was also closed with no option for room service or a snack. What hotel doesn’t do room service? The following afternoon the restaurant and bar were also closed however I was eventually given a random sandwich menu from the receptionist which was abysmal. The rooms were like the pits of hell. No aircon. Horrendous water pressure and taps that don’t know if they are hot or cold. The bed was hard and lumpy and the entire hotel has this putrid yellow tone to it highlighting how old and tired the entire place is. From the outside it actually looks like an old folks retirement home. The carpets are worn down and old, the furniture is like it’s from a charity shop and the staff were all friendly however utterly clueless and unhelpful. The only thing the regency has going for it is a semi decent old gym from the 80s. We eventually had the opportunity to try some of the cruising on offer at breakfast - sadly I wish we hadn’t. Apparently asking for some scrambled eggs is too mind blowing for the staff and chef to comprehend. It’s safe to say that we will never be returning here and we couldn’t get out of there fast enough.
